The Flaws announce details of debut album

Monaghan lads The Flaws will release their debut album Achieving Vagueness this autumn, following a busy summer of touring, and a new single.

The Hot Press Newsdesk, 10 Jul 2007

The latest single by Carrickmacross foursome The Flaws will be released on July 27. The song ‘1981’ also appears on the band’s debut album Achieving Vagueness, out on September 14.

The ten-track record will feature the radio hit ‘Sixteen,’ which appeared on the band’s 2005 EP and was put out as a single earlier this year.

The Flaws take to the road supporting the Thrills this summer, playing the Nerve Centre, Derry (July 26); Spring And Airbrake, Belfast (July 27); The Village, Dublin (July 28); Cyprus Avenue, Cork (August 2); Roisin Dubh, Galway (August 4).

The also play a host of festival dates in Ireland and Europe: Meltfestival, Germany (July 14); Castlepalooza Festival Tullamore Co Offaly (August 5); Indie-Pendence Festival, Mitchelstown, Cork (August 5); Feile Beo Festival, Dingle, Kerry (August 19); Le Cheile Festival, Meath (August 3).
